County Of Los Angeles Primary Care Adult West is an addiction treatment center located at 2010 Zonal Avenue, Opd 4p41, Rooms 1-34 in the 90033 zip code in Los Angeles, CA. It is operated by the local government. County Of Los Angeles Primary Care Adult West provides buprenorphine maintenance, prescribes suboxone and administers naltrexone. Some of the treatment approaches used by County Of Los Angeles Primary Care Adult West include counseling for trauma victims, brief intervention services and substance use counseling approach. County Of Los Angeles Primary Care Adult West provides inpatient hospital addiction treatment, outpatient methadone/buprenorphine/naltrexone treatment and regular outpatient heroin treatment. It also provides residential treatment for dual diagnosis and residential treatment for heroin abuse.
